protected override bool OnKeyDown(KeyDownEvent e)
{
switch (e.Key)
{
case Key.Left:
moveSelection(new Vector2(-1, 0));
return true;
case Key.Right:
moveSelection(new Vector2(1, 0));
return true;
case Key.Up:
moveSelection(new Vector2(0, -1));
return true;
case Key.Down:
moveSelection(new Vector2(0, 1));
return true;
}
return false;
}
/// <summary>
/// Move the current selection spatially by the specified delta, in screen coordinates (ie. the same coordinates as the blueprints).
/// </summary>
/// <param name="delta"></param>
private void moveSelection(Vector2 delta)
{
var firstBlueprint = SelectionHandler.SelectedBlueprints.FirstOrDefault();
if (firstBlueprint == null)
return;
// convert to game space coordinates
delta = firstBlueprint.ToScreenSpace(delta) - firstBlueprint.ToScreenSpace(Vector2.Zero);
SelectionHandler.HandleMovement(new MoveSelectionEvent<ISkinnableDrawable>(firstBlueprint, delta));
}
